Rivian Automotive is recalling approximately 2,334 vehicles, including certain 2023-2024 EDV, R1S, and R1T models, because the headlights may be improperly aimed. This defect means the vehicles do not meet federal safety standards for lighting equipment. Rivian will inspect all affected vehicles and adjust the headlight alignment as necessary at no cost to the owner.
If headlights are not aimed correctly, they may not provide enough light on the road ahead. This reduces the driver's visibility during dark conditions, which increases the risk of a crash.
Free inspection and headlight alignment adjustment.
